The Farelab ticket-pricing experiment service rejected last night's config push with a signature mismatch, so the new fare variants never went live and all venues fell back to baseline pricing. Root cause: the config was signed with the retired staging key after last week's rotation. No customer-facing pricing errors occurred. Support should tell experimenters to re-sign configs with the current key and resubmit; pushes verified against it deploy normally. The active verification key is below.

release key, bahof-hafog: bky3_ztf

Subject: Updated ownership of the order-cutoff rule

Team, please note a change affecting how we handle cutoff disputes at Millwheel Bakehouse. The 2 p.m. same-day order cutoff in the Crumbline portal now has a single designated owner who approves any exceptions, including wholesale accounts. Do not grant extensions yourself; route every request through the proper queue with the order number attached. All escalations regarding the cutoff rule should now go to the following person.

named custodian: Brivan Eliath Quenox Frador

Subject: Rotated key for Fanline fan-out service

Hey — since you're reviewing the backpressure PR anyway, heads up that we rotated the Fanline notification fan-out key this morning. The old one gets revoked Thursday. This matters for your review because the retry logic in the queue consumer now re-authenticates on 401s instead of crashing, so please sanity-check that path. Staging already has the new credential; local dev needs it added to your env file manually. For local testing, use the new key below:

service key, fawip-bajef: kto11_Qt5wZK9vdNC

# Runbook: Hunting leaked file descriptors in Quillgate

When the `fd_open` gauge climbs steadily between deploys, suspect a leak rather than load. First confirm on a single pod: exec in and count entries under `/proc/1/fd`, noting how many are sockets in CLOSE_WAIT versus regular files. Capture two snapshots ten minutes apart before restarting anything — we need the delta for the postmortem. Reproduce locally with the Marbury load harness, which requires the service running with the following configuration values.

settings of yagep-bajog:
[istdor]
port = 4000
region = south-2
host = istdor.qorvelcorp.internal
timeout_ms = 5000
retries = 5